Transaction 3407e2ff25684fae5ce4afc2eea53c1321603919a301de3a915a9b2c9c068b1d
1 Input
1 Output
-
3407e2ff25684fae5ce4afc2eea53c1321603919a301de3a915a9b2c9c068b1d:0
- value
- 3326962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9200b7066d1fa43e12b03e73b571a560bc7146d5 OP_EQUAL
- address
- 3F11SE4bPwwUArLgtypUQAZ6KAfm7NAGN6